Default Backspace randomly starts deleting bullets...


I write a lot of lecture outlines in MS Word using bullets. It works
extremely well, however, the funniest thing happens and I'd love to be able
to stop it.

Everything will work great for a time:

When I press tab, the bullet will indent one tab forward.
When I press backspace, the bullet will de-indent one tab backward.

.... then, all of the sudden, without any purposeful doing on my part:

When I press tab, the bullet will indent one tab forward.
However, when I press backspace, it deletes the bullet.

.... and this continues for the rest of the document and I can't seem to
resolve it (i.e. get it to go back to de-indenting my bullet instead of
deleting it when I press back space).

If anybody could offer up any solution to this, it would mean a great deal.
